6 Foods to Eat Every Week for Better Brain Health

5 min read
  • The MIND diet, rich in brain-friendly foods, may reduce risk of Alzheimer’s and dementia.
  • Leafy greens, eggs and salmon may help support memory and general brain function.
  • Blueberries, lamb and walnuts offer nutrients that support cognition and overall brain health.
